Output 52fee9263121c5ec5dc43e38663288ece87e9ce282014d0ff09157f1c7a5dd99:0

value
33026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853e17606dcc4707b435a186a5406034c438f71d OP_EQUAL
address
3DqYBEitpj57gA3dYijJW8WStmj5YzRfR8
transaction
52fee9263121c5ec5dc43e38663288ece87e9ce282014d0ff09157f1c7a5dd99